CBS Renews Queen Latifah led Action Series, The Equalizer

“The Equalizer” fans can rejoice as CBS has officially renewed the drama for its fifth season, slated to air during the 2024-2025 broadcast season. This renewal news brings relief to viewers, especially amid uncertainties about the fate of other CBS shows like “NCIS: Hawai’i.” Amy Reisenbach, president of CBS Entertainment, highlighted the series’ compelling elements,…
